SMIME Mails from Outlook 2010 can't get decrypted on Mac Mail or Entourage

Today we dicovered a problem with encrypted Mails.
Sending with Outlook 2007 to Mac Mail oder Entourage works well, but if you use a Outlook 2010 Client for encrypting a mail, this mail can't be decrypted on a Mac. In the other direction it works all well, so Mac can send encrypted to Outlook 2010 that can decrypt the mail.

Anyone any idea?

p.s. of course we tried diferent PCs and Macs

In the the header of the Mails I could only find one difference:
the one who can be decrypted correctly (send from Outlook 2007)
 Content-Type:       application/x-pkcs7-mime; smime-type=enveloped-data; name="smime.p7m"
 Content-Disposition:       attachment; filename="smime.p7m"
 Content-Transfer-Encoding:       base64
 Mime-Version:       1.0
the one what is noc decrypted (send with Outlook 2010):
 Content-Type:       application/pkcs7-mime; smime-type=enveloped-data; name="smime.p7m"
 Content-Disposition:       attachment; filename="smime.p7m"
 Content-Transfer-Encoding:       base64
 Mime-Version:       1.0

So Content rype differs, on Outlook 2010it is not:   application/x-pkcs7-mime
pkcs7-mime is correct, but x-pkcs7-mime has been around longer. It is possible that pkcs7-mime is not being recognized by Mail.

Easy to test: locate one of the affected emlx files (in a messages folder a few layers deep in ~/Library/Mail/), edit the header with textwrangler or another text editor (to add the"x-"), and see mail can read it now.
